About the Business

The Swiss Family Treehouse is a whimsical attraction located at 1180 Seven Seas Drive in Lake Buena Vista, Florida, within an amusement park setting. Visitors can explore the intricately designed treehouse inspired by the classic Disney film "Swiss Family Robinson." Climb up winding staircases and across swaying bridges to discover the enchanting living quarters of the fictional family. En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ding park as you immerse yourself in this charming and nostalgic experience. Perfect for families and fans of the beloved movie, the Swiss Family Treehouse offers a unique and memorable adventure for all ages.

"Swiss famly treehouse received a minor holiday overlay on the attraction. The organ instead of playing that catchy tune is playing Christmas carols! Following the movie of the 60s signs point to the primative lifestyle the family endured while being shipwrecked on a desert island. See the kitchen, the library, the family room, the parent's bedroom, and the boy's bedroom. Some climbing is involved but the steps provide railings for safety. Check out the water can system outside that bring up cold water to the family. There is never a wait for this attraction. You must be able to walk stairs to enjoy it. Most of the scenes are behind netting adding to the effect that the family needed to protect themselves against wild animals in the jungle. Located in Adventureland."
